Identifying Hidden Leaks

Some leaks are easy to see, like a dripping faucet or a wet wall. But others hide behind walls, under floors, or in crawl spaces. These can cause mold, rot, and structural damage over time. Our technicians use thermal imaging and moisture meters to detect leaks you can’t see. It’s a fast, non-invasive way to find the problem. You don’t want to ignore these signs. Water Leak Detection: DIY vs. Professional Help

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small leak under a sink Yes No It’s manageable with basic tools and quick action.
Wet floor with no visible source No Yes It could be hidden behind walls or under floors.
Water dripping from the ceiling No Yes This could be a serious leak that needs expert help.
High water bill with no obvious cause No Yes It might be a hidden leak that’s costing you money.
Musty smell in a room No Yes It could be mold from a water leak that needs attention.
Leak from a pipe in the wall No Yes It’s risky to try fixing it yourself without the right tools.

It’s important to know when to call a professional. Some leaks are easy to handle, but others need expert help to prevent more damage. You don’t want to risk your home or your safety. Water Leak Detection Cost In The 99151 Area

Water leak detection costs vary depending on the size of the problem and how quickly it’s addressed. You might pay more if the leak has caused extensive damage or if it’s hidden in hard-to-reach areas. The 99151 area has a mix of old and new homes, so the cost can depend on the building’s condition and the type of plumbing. These are general estimates, not guarantees. It’s best to get a free assessment to get an accurate idea of what you’ll need.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Leak detection inspection $200 – $400 Size of the area and complexity of the system.
Moisture mapping $150 – $300 Number of rooms and types of materials involved.
Thermal imaging scan $100 – $250 Access to areas and equipment used.
Pipe repair or replacement $500 – $1,500 Length of pipe and materials needed.
Structural drying $300 – $800 Size of area and level of moisture.
Water extraction $200 – $500 Amount of water and location of the leak.
